10 tips to save on your car rental in and around Aurora

  1. Use filters to find the right car: Refine your search by selecting vehicle type and features. Whether you're looking for an SUV for added space, a convertible for summer fun, or an economy car to save money, utilize the filters on Expedia to discover the perfect option for your trip.
  2. Book in advance to help lower costs: Rental prices can vary with demand, so it's wise to secure your car well ahead of your travel dates. By booking early, you're more likely to lock in lower rates and enjoy greater availability, particularly during peak seasons.
  3. Consider a smaller car for savings: Compact cars are typically more affordable to rent and easier to navigate in crowded areas. Mid-size rentals offer a solid compromise between cost, comfort, and fuel efficiency.
  4. Age guidelines: Drivers under 30 may encounter higher deposits or daily surcharges, and some vehicle types—such as SUVs or premium models—might be unavailable. This can also apply to renters over 70 years old. Always verify the age requirements before making a reservation.
  5. Check fuel policies: Some rentals operate on a full-to-full fuel policy, which means you must return the car with a full tank to avoid additional fees. This is usually the most advantageous option. Others may provide full-to-empty or prepaid fueling choices, which are also acceptable. Just remember to return the car empty in that case.
  6. Save on city and airport pickups: Picking up your rental car at airports often incurs a surcharge, but the added convenience may make it worthwhile.
  7. Know your payment options: Many car rental companies only accept credit cards for payment.
  8. Understand your insurance coverage: Rental car insurance can help you avoid unexpected expenses and provides peace of mind in case of unforeseen events during your trip. Adding car rental insurance when booking with Expedia is a simple process.
  9. Consider unlimited mileage: If you plan on taking long road trips, look for rental options that offer unlimited mileage to steer clear of extra charges.
  10. Bring your driver's license and ID: A valid driver's license is essential for renting a car.

How old do you have to be to rent a car in Aurora?
The minimum age to rent a vehicle in Aurora is 21. An extra fee for young drivers generally applies, so check before booking and budget for any extra costs. There may also be restrictions on the types of vehicles available to young drivers. For example, some companies will only rent out economy to medium-sized cars to young motorists. Rules vary between providers, so be sure to read the fine print carefully.
What do you need to rent a car in Aurora?
The main things are your driver's license and a credit card in the same name. Most car rental companies will offer you insurance, which is optional. But you may have to provide proof of alternative coverage if you choose to opt out. We recommend checking with your supplier to avoid any problems.
